国产人妻人伦精品_欧美一区二区三区图_亚洲欧洲久久_日韩美女av在线免费观看

合肥生活安徽新聞合肥交通合肥房產(chǎn)生活服務合肥教育合肥招聘合肥旅游文化藝術合肥美食合肥地圖合肥社保合肥醫(yī)院企業(yè)服務合肥法律

COMP2010J代做、代寫c/c++,Python程序
COMP2010J代做、代寫c/c++,Python程序

時間:2024-12-06  來源:合肥網(wǎng)hfw.cc  作者:hfw.cc 我要糾錯



COMP2010J: Data Structures and Algorithms
Assignment 2: Hash Table
Implementation and Word Search
Efffciency
Dr. Nima Afraz and Abdul Wadud
Deadline: 25th November, 2024
Instructions
• This is an individual assignment.
• Submit your code and report as a single zip ffle through the course
portal.
• Ensure your code is well-documented with comments explaining your
thought process.
• Label each section and question clearly in your submission.
• Late submissions will be penalized (see grading scheme).
Overview
In this assignment, you will build a dictionary system using a hash table to
store and search words. You will explore the efffciency of hash map operations
by working with two datasets: one containing 1,000 words and another with
10,000 words. The assignment consists of three main parts: constructing a
hash table, measuring the performance of word searches, and implementing
a word suggestion system for unmatched searches.
1Part 1: Building the Hash Table and Menu
System (50 Marks)
You are required to:
• Load two datasets, small dataset.csv (1K words) and large dataset.csv
(10K words), into separate hash maps.
• Implement a method to load the datasets and insert words into the
hash maps.
• Create a menu-driven system that allows the user to search for words
or exit the program.
Menu System Requirements
Implement a simple command-line menu that runs in an inffnite loop and
provides the following options:
1. Search for a word in the 1K dataset: The program should prompt
the user to enter a word and search for it in the hash map containing
the 1K dataset. Display the result (word found with count or word not
found), along with the computational time and number of comparisons.
2. Search for a word in the 10K dataset: The program should prompt
the user to enter a word and search for it in the hash map containing
the 10K dataset. Display the result as above.
3. Exit the program: Allow the user to exit the loop and terminate the
program.
Example Code for Menu System:
1 while ( true ) {
2 System . out. println ("\ nMenu :");
3 System . out. println ("1. Search for a word in the 1K
dataset ");
4 System . out. println ("2. Search for a word in the 10K
dataset ");
5 System . out. println ("3. Exit ");
6 System . out. print (" Enter your choice : ");
7 }
Listing 1: Menu System Implementation
2Tasks:
• Task 1.1 (20 Marks): Write a method to insert words into the hash
map, ensuring that duplicate words are counted.
• Task 1.2 (20 Marks): Implement the menu system as described above
to allow for word searches in both datasets.
• Task 1.3 (10 Marks): Implement a function to display the contents
of the hash map, showing each word and its count.
Figure 1: Sample Output for the Word Search Program
Part 2: Searching and Performance Analysis
(40 Marks)
This part focuses on the efffciency of searching words in hash maps of different
sizes.
Tasks:
• Task 2.1 (20 Marks): Implement a method to search for a word in
the hash map and print whether it was found, along with its count.
– Search for ’aaron’ for both small (1K) and large (10K) dataset
and add the results (screenshot/table) in the report.
• Task 2.2 (15 Marks): Measure the computational time for searching
a word in the 1K dataset and the 10K dataset. Display the time taken
for each search.
• Task 2.3 (15 Marks): Implement logic to count the number of comparisons
 made during the search and display this count for each search.
3• For task 2.2 and 2.3, test the system for three given words in the
Table. 1. State computational time taken and comparisons for each
word.
Word 1K Dataset 10K Dataset
CompTime (ns) Comparisons CompTime (ns) Comparisons
beijing
monica
angel
Table 1: Comparison of computational time and number of comparisons for
words in the 1K and 10K datasets.
Performance Comparison
After completing the searches, you are required to:
• Compare the average time taken to search words in the 1K dataset
versus the 10K dataset.
• Analyze the results and write a short explanation of why the hash map
remains efffcient even with a larger dataset, using Big-O notation to
support your ffndings.
Submission Guidelines
Submit a single zipped folder to Brightspace containing:
1. Your code, including all class ffles and any additional documentation.
2. A PDF report (max 5 pages) explaining your implementation, code
structure, algorithms used, and performance analysis.
Name your zip ffle: ucdconnectid p2.zip
Example Naming Convention
If your UCD Connect ID is 12345678, your submission should be named:
12345678 p2.zip.
4How to Export a Project to a Zip File
• In IntelliJ, go to File | Export | Project to Zip File.
• Specify the path and click Save to create the zip file.
Grading Scheme
Correctness (50%)
• The code should perform as described and meet the problem requirements.
Efficiency
(30%)
• The program should demonstrate efficient use of the hash map for
searching.
Presentation (20%)
• The report should be clear, well-structured, and include explanations
of the code and results.
Late Submission Penalties
• Less than 15 minutes late: No penalty.
• 15 minutes to 2 hours late: 25% deduction.
• More than 2 hours late: 50% deduction.


請加QQ:99515681  郵箱:99515681@qq.com   WX:codinghelp

掃一掃在手機打開當前頁
  • 上一篇:代寫EE5434、代做c/c++,Java程序
  • 下一篇:代做AnDe 、代寫Pokemon 程序設計
  • ·COMP09110代做、代寫Python程序設計
  • · COMP338編程代做、代寫Python程序語言
  • ·代寫MATH36031、Python程序設計代做
  • ·CDS523編程代寫、代做Python程序語言
  • ·代做CMPT 477、Java/Python程序代寫
  • ·代做COMP9021、python程序設計代寫
  • ·COMP0035代做、代寫python程序語言
  • ·代寫COMP0034、代做Java/Python程序設計
  • ·MSE 280代做、代寫C++,Python程序
  • ·CS540編程代寫、代做Python程序設計
  • 合肥生活資訊

    合肥圖文信息
    流體仿真外包多少錢_專業(yè)CFD分析代做_友商科技CAE仿真
    流體仿真外包多少錢_專業(yè)CFD分析代做_友商科
    CAE仿真分析代做公司 CFD流體仿真服務 管路流場仿真外包
    CAE仿真分析代做公司 CFD流體仿真服務 管路
    流體CFD仿真分析_代做咨詢服務_Fluent 仿真技術服務
    流體CFD仿真分析_代做咨詢服務_Fluent 仿真
    結(jié)構(gòu)仿真分析服務_CAE代做咨詢外包_剛強度疲勞振動
    結(jié)構(gòu)仿真分析服務_CAE代做咨詢外包_剛強度疲
    流體cfd仿真分析服務 7類仿真分析代做服務40個行業(yè)
    流體cfd仿真分析服務 7類仿真分析代做服務4
    超全面的拼多多電商運營技巧,多多開團助手,多多出評軟件徽y1698861
    超全面的拼多多電商運營技巧,多多開團助手
    CAE有限元仿真分析團隊,2026仿真代做咨詢服務平臺
    CAE有限元仿真分析團隊,2026仿真代做咨詢服
    釘釘簽到打卡位置修改神器,2026怎么修改定位在范圍內(nèi)
    釘釘簽到打卡位置修改神器,2026怎么修改定
  • 短信驗證碼 寵物飼養(yǎng) 十大衛(wèi)浴品牌排行 suno 豆包網(wǎng)頁版入口 wps 目錄網(wǎng) 排行網(wǎng)

    關于我們 | 打賞支持 | 廣告服務 | 聯(lián)系我們 | 網(wǎng)站地圖 | 免責聲明 | 幫助中心 | 友情鏈接 |

    Copyright © 2025 hfw.cc Inc. All Rights Reserved. 合肥網(wǎng) 版權所有
    ICP備06013414號-3 公安備 42010502001045

    国产人妻人伦精品_欧美一区二区三区图_亚洲欧洲久久_日韩美女av在线免费观看
    国产欧美一区二区三区不卡高清| 欧美乱大交xxxxx潮喷l头像| 婷婷五月色综合| 国产一区高清视频| 国产精品视频免费一区二区三区| 亚洲人久久久| 成人国产在线看| 欧美精品做受xxx性少妇| 欧美精品成人网| 色偷偷9999www| 日韩高清专区| 久久免费少妇高潮久久精品99| 国产精品老女人视频| 日韩男女性生活视频| 久久精品日产第一区二区三区精品版 | 国产经品一区二区| 欧美激情一区二区三区在线视频观看| 国模一区二区三区私拍视频| 国产精品网址在线| 青青草国产精品| 波霸ol色综合久久| 黄色三级中文字幕| 国产精品极品美女粉嫩高清在线| 精品一区国产| 精品国产一区二区三| 国产色综合一区二区三区| 国产精品高清网站| 国产内射老熟女aaaa| 中文字幕日韩一区二区三区| 国产精品一区二区久久| 宅男一区二区三区| 91精品国产成人www| 日本一本a高清免费不卡| 九色在线视频观看| 青草视频在线观看视频| 国产精品日韩二区| 国产日韩精品电影| 亚洲aⅴ日韩av电影在线观看| 久久久久狠狠高潮亚洲精品| 日本一欧美一欧美一亚洲视频| 日韩视频在线一区| 国产原创欧美精品| 亚洲一区制服诱惑| 国产成人精品视频ⅴa片软件竹菊| 日本一区免费在线观看| 久久精品国产69国产精品亚洲| 欧美 日韩 亚洲 一区| 精品蜜桃传媒| 99久久久久国产精品免费| 久久成人国产精品| 久久久亚洲影院| 欧美性资源免费| 中文字幕人成一区| 久久99久久精品国产| 激情六月丁香婷婷| 一道精品一区二区三区| 久久久噜噜噜久久中文字免| 狠狠色综合欧美激情| 久久国产精品久久国产精品| 久久综合九九| 黄色小网站91| 亚洲一二区在线| 国产成人一区二| 国产综合精品一区二区三区| 欧美精品性视频| 久在线观看视频| 免费在线观看日韩视频| 一区二区三区四区在线视频| 国产成人成网站在线播放青青| 欧美精品欧美精品| 亚洲综合中文字幕在线| 久久久久免费精品| 国产精品一区二区三区在线| 日韩av电影免费播放| 久久亚洲精品视频| 国产成人avxxxxx在线看| 精品一区久久久| 日韩在线观看a| 国产精品狠色婷| 久久久久久综合网天天| 国产乱人伦精品一区二区三区| 日韩亚洲在线视频| 一区不卡视频| 国产精品美女xx| 国产精品99导航| 久久人人爽人人| 国产日韩欧美亚洲一区| 日本a视频在线观看| 欧美精品第一页在线播放| 国产l精品国产亚洲区久久| 国产精品久久久久久久小唯西川 | 视频一区二区视频| 国产精品久久久久久久久久免费| 91精品国产99| 国产拍精品一二三| 热久久美女精品天天吊色| 伊人婷婷久久| 国产精品久久久久久久天堂第1集| 国产精品88a∨| 国产一区二区久久久| 欧美国产亚洲一区| 日本一区精品| 欧美激情区在线播放| 国产精品网站视频| 久久久国产精品一区二区三区| 国产日韩一区在线| 虎白女粉嫩尤物福利视频| 日本不卡一二三区| 岛国一区二区三区高清视频| 欧美日韩国产成人在线观看| 国产成人无码av在线播放dvd| 国产精品91在线观看| 成人国产精品色哟哟| 国产日韩欧美二区| 免费高清在线观看免费| 日韩国产小视频| 夜夜添无码一区二区三区| 国产精品区免费视频| 色婷婷久久av| 久久9精品区-无套内射无码| 99热成人精品热久久66| 国产色一区二区三区| 国内精品久久久久久久久| 欧美视频第一区| 青青草原一区二区| 欧美中文字幕精品| 日本精品久久久久影院| 日本一区二区在线| 色综合av综合无码综合网站| 亚洲va码欧洲m码| 亚州欧美日韩中文视频| 中文视频一区视频二区视频三区| 国产精品成人一区二区三区 | 欧美一级爱爱视频| 任我爽在线视频精品一| 人体精品一二三区| 欧美亚洲国产免费| 激情视频小说图片| 国产一区免费视频| 国产免费一区| 俄罗斯精品一区二区| 97人人模人人爽视频一区二区 | 一区二区三区四区五区视频| 欧美日韩xxxxx| 一区二区视频在线观看| 夜夜添无码一区二区三区| 亚洲精品欧美一区二区三区| 亚洲国产精品久久久久爰色欲 | 国产欧美日韩小视频| 国产自产在线视频| 国产欧美日韩精品专区| 国产欧美日本在线| 成人国产精品一区| 97久久精品人人澡人人爽缅北| 91国偷自产一区二区三区的观看方式 | 国产99在线|中文| 亚洲精品影院| 日本一区网站| 激情小视频网站| 国产精品中文久久久久久久| 国产精选久久久久久| 77777亚洲午夜久久多人| 国产激情美女久久久久久吹潮| 久久久久久久久久av| 国产精品久久久久久久久久久久冷 | 日韩欧美一级在线| 欧美成人蜜桃| 国产区一区二区三区| y111111国产精品久久婷婷| 91.com在线| www.日韩免费| 欧美成人在线免费| 五月天亚洲综合情| 欧美日韩成人一区二区三区| 国产欧美日韩精品专区| 国产成人aa精品一区在线播放| www.欧美精品| 欧美激情中文字幕在线| 手机看片福利永久国产日韩| 欧美性在线观看| www黄色av| 久久精品国产69国产精品亚洲| 一区二区三区在线视频看| 日韩少妇内射免费播放| 国产欧美精品日韩精品| 久草在在线视频| 国产99在线播放| 日韩免费av一区二区| 国产精品一香蕉国产线看观看| 久久青青草综合| 欧美精品一二区| 日韩在线综合网| 国产一区喷水| 久久久久久精| 一区二区不卡在线| 欧美牲交a欧美牲交aⅴ免费真| 国产麻豆一区二区三区在线观看 | 欧美成人精品一区| 日韩免费在线观看av| 国产精品一区专区欧美日韩|